Iranians in Athens and Rome strongly condemn and protest against the repression of demonstrators

Iranians living in Greece gathered outside the Iranian embassy in Athens on Friday evening, over Iran’s crackdown on protesters.

According to Associated Press Protesters chanted, waved flags and held signs that read "We’re with our sisters in Iran!" and "Women, life, freedom!"

Iran’s government has been shutting down access to the internet and limiting phone calls for days, making it nearly impossible for Iranians in the diaspora to find out if their families back home are safe.

Taheri Fara, an Iranian protester who living in Greece for 20 years, was waiting on news about her mother.

"Every day I open my phone and read, trying to find something, to see if I might find them among the dead, but unfortunately now information comes out drop by drop so we do not know what is happening,” said Fara.

Protests that began Dec. 28 over an ailing economy and morphed into protests directly challenging the country’s theocracy seem to have stopped. There have been no signs of protests for days in Tehran, where shopping and street life have returned to outward normality, though a week-old internet blackout continued.

Authorities have not reported any unrest elsewhere in the country.

Still, the U.S.-based Human Rights Activists News Agency on Friday put the death toll from demonstrations at 2,797, and that number continues to rise.

President Donald Trump took the unusual step on Friday of thanking the Iranian government for not following through on executions of what he said was meant to be hundreds of political prisoners.

Those sentiments come after Trump spent days suggesting that the U.S. might strike Iran militarily if its government triggered mass killings during widespread protests that swept that country but now have quieted.

Hundreds gathered in front of Rome’s city hall on Friday to demonstrate in solidarity with protesters in Iran and against the Iranian government.

Across Europe, thousands of exiled Iranians have taken to the streets to shout out their rage at the government of the Islamic Republic which has cracked down on protests in their homeland, reportedly killing thousands of people.

Women have taken a prominent role in organizing the protests abroad, raising their voices against the theocratic government that discriminates against them.

But beyond the anger, there’s also a sense of fear and paralysis.

Iran’s government has been shutting down the internet and limiting phone calls for days, making it nearly impossible for Iranians in the diaspora to find out if their families back home are safe.

Harsh repression that has left several thousand people dead appears to have succeeded in stifling demonstrations that began December 28 over Iran’s ailing economy and morphed into protests directly challenging the country’s theocracy.
